2025-03-02 Rico Tzschichholz Release 0.56.18 Add CI for tarball release service 2025-03-02 Zhou Qiankang glib-2.0: Add Regex.escape_nul in GLib See: https://docs.gtk.org/glib/type_func.Regex.escape_nul.html 2025-03-02 Rico Tzschichholz tests: Prepend $(builddir) to gir file target to increase coverage 2025-03-02 Zhou Qiankang glib-2.0: Update RegexMatchFlags and RegexCompileFlags's binding to 2.74 2025-02-18 Zhou Qiankang valadoc: Sync gir argument handling from valacompiler.vala 2025-02-18 arujjval Update links to GNOME Wiki project and refer to new Vala websites 2025-02-18 Rico Tzschichholz girparser: Handle `doc:format` element in root:repository See https://gitlab.gnome.org/GNOME/gobject-introspection/-/issues/448 Fixes https://gitlab.gnome.org/GNOME/vala/issues/1586 2025-02-18 Dawid Duma gobject-2.0: Add TypeFlags missing values 2025-02-18 Rico Tzschichholz build: Update gitlog-to-changelog to latest upstream From commit 7b08932179d0d6b017f7df01a2ddf6e096b038e3 of https://git.savannah.gnu.org/cgit/gnulib.git/tree/build-aux/gitlog-to-changelog 2025-02-18 Mario Daniel Ruiz Saavedra sdl2: Fix missing integer type for JoystickID Fixes https://gitlab.gnome.org/GNOME/vala/issues/1563 2024-06-24 Ole André Vadla Ravnås Håvard Sørbø libusb-1.0: Fix the LibUSB.HotPlugCb declaration It returns an int used to decide whether the callback should be rearmed or deregistered. libusb-1.0: Fix the LibUSB.TransferCb declaration The target is part of the Transfer object, and is not passed as a parameter. gio-2.0: Improve the {Input,Output}Message bindings Where some in/out fields were incorrectly typed. 2024-06-24 Rico Tzschichholz sdl2: Fix CCode.destroy_function of SDL.RWops and usage of SDL.RWops.from_file() Fixes https://gitlab.gnome.org/GNOME/vala/issues/1550 2024-05-29 Rico Tzschichholz tests: Update property notify test for G_PARAM_EXPLICIT_NOTIFY GLib 2.42 is mandatory for some time. codegen: Fix conditional expression with only one void side Found by -pedantic-errors 2024-05-29 Rico Tzschichholz test: Avoid redeclaration of gint In addition to e4fe55735fb3e151dd6340b6d3fb8acca38193a4 Found by -pedantic-errors 2024-05-29 Rico Tzschichholz tests: Don't take the chance to conflict with C99 constant of stdbool.h glib-2.0: Make FileStream.*printf() return int Fixes https://gitlab.gnome.org/GNOME/vala/issues/1547 codegen: Use correct ctype for result variable in methods in more cases glib-2.0: Add missing CCode.array_null_terminated attributes to IConv.iconv() 2024-05-29 Zhou Qiankang glib-2.0: Fix the binding of `get_console_charset` The parameters of `g_get_console_charset` is `const char**`, the same as `g_get_charset`, is a NUL terminated UTF-8 string. 2024-05-29 Rico Tzschichholz docs: Bump vala version references in README.md 2024-05-29 Zhou Qiankang vala, libvaladoc: Fix color support detection in log reporting Use `GLib.Log.writer_supports_color` to replace vala's implementation `is_atty` 2024-05-29 Rico Tzschichholz vapi: Pass --girdir $GIRDIR to vapigen Otherwise only vala's installation prefix is used to resolve dependencies for the given gir file. vala: Don't allow inheritance of compact class from non-compact class gstreamer-1.0: Skip ParamSpecArray and ParamSpecFraction 2024-05-29 Reuben Thomas gnu: add binding for 'relocate' APIs 2022-02-08 Rico Tzschichholz 2021-09-14 Gustav Hartvigsson 2021-09-14 Rico Tzschichholz 2020-10-20 Rico Tzschichholz 2020-05-22 wb9688 <36312-wb9688@users.noreply.gitlab.gnome.org> 2020-05-22 Rico Tzschichholz 2019-10-18 Rico Tzschichholz 2019-03-27 Rico Tzschichholz 2019-03-27 Rico Tzschichholz 2019-01-05 Rico Tzschichholz 2018-12-19 Rico Tzschichholz 2018-12-19 Rico Tzschichholz 2018-12-19 Rico Tzschichholz 2018-12-19 Rico Tzschichholz 2018-12-19 Rico Tzschichholz 2018-12-19 Rico Tzschichholz 2018-04-13 Rico Tzschichholz 2018-03-27 Rico Tzschichholz 2017-12-08 Rico Tzschichholz 2017-12-08 Rico Tzschichholz 2017-12-06 George Barrett 2017-02-14 Rico Tzschichholz 2016-11-11 Rico Tzschichholz 2016-10-08 Rico Tzschichholz 2016-01-16 Florian Brosch 2015-11-23 Rico Tzschichholz 2014-11-16 Simon Werbeck 2014-08-25 Rico Tzschichholz 2014-08-21 Rico Tzschichholz 2014-08-20 Luca Bruno 2014-08-16 Evan Nemerson 2014-07-01 Evan Nemerson 2014-06-26 Evan Nemerson 2014-06-14 Evan Nemerson 2014-06-12 Evan Nemerson 2014-06-04 Evan Nemerson 2014-05-20 Evan Nemerson 2014-05-14 Robert Ancell 2014-04-17 Ryan Lortie 2014-04-17 Ryan Lortie 2014-03-30 Robert Ancell 2013-10-25 Philip Withnall 2013-09-23 Florian Brosch 2013-09-19 Florian Brosch 2013-09-16 Richard Schwarting 2013-09-08 Jamie McCracken 2013-06-05 Michal Hruby 2013-03-19 Luca Bruno 2013-03-19 Luca Bruno 2013-02-06 Florian Brosch 2012-11-29 Florian Brosch 2012-11-28 Florian Brosch 2012-11-26 Florian Brosch 2012-11-20 Evan Nemerson 2012-10-23 Evan Nemerson 2012-10-13 Florian Brosch 2012-10-10 Evan Nemerson 2012-10-01 Florian Brosch 2012-09-15 Rico Tzschichholz 2012-09-15 Evan Nemerson 2012-08-20 Florian Brosch 2012-08-16 Philip Withnall 2012-08-16 Florian Brosch 2012-08-14 Florian Brosch 2012-08-14 Philip Withnall 2012-08-09 Florian Brosch 2012-08-06 Evan Nemerson 2012-08-06 Florian Brosch 2012-06-25 Evan Nemerson 2012-06-16 Evan Nemerson 2012-06-07 Alexander Kurtz 2012-06-07 Evan Nemerson 2012-06-07 Richard Schwarting 2012-06-07 Evan Nemerson 2012-06-05 Evan Nemerson 2012-06-02 Richard Schwarting 2012-05-05 Evan Nemerson 2012-05-04 Evan Nemerson 2012-02-12 Evan Nemerson 2012-01-29 Florian Brosch 2012-01-22 Florian Brosch 2012-01-06 Florian Brosch 2012-01-06 Evan Nemerson 2011-11-20 Marc-André Lureau 2011-11-20 Jason Conti 2011-10-05 Florian Brosch 2011-09-22 Evan Nemerson 2011-08-26 Evan Nemerson 2011-08-22 Luca Bruno 2011-08-12 Florian Brosch 2011-08-10 Florian Brosch 2011-08-03 Luca Bruno 2011-08-01 Luca Bruno 2011-07-27 Michal Hruby 2011-07-25 Evan Nemerson 2011-07-22 Evan Nemerson 2011-03-30 Michael 'Mickey' Lauer 2011-03-19 Marco Trevisan (Treviño) 2011-02-27 Jamie McCracken 2011-02-23 Florian Brosch 2011-02-14 Florian Brosch 2011-02-13 Florian Brosch 2011-02-10 Jürg Billeter 2011-02-04 Evan Nemerson 2011-02-01 Florian Brosch 2011-01-28 Jürg Billeter 2011-01-23 Evan Nemerson 2011-01-19 Evan Nemerson 2011-01-16 Luca Bruno 2011-01-08 Jürg Billeter 2011-01-05 Jürg Billeter 2010-12-22 Michael 'Mickey' Lauer 2010-12-17 Evan Nemerson 2010-11-17 Luca Bruno 2010-11-04 Evan Nemerson 2010-10-26 Evan Nemerson 2010-10-23 Evan Nemerson 2010-10-13 Jürg Billeter 2010-10-07 Jürg Billeter 2010-10-06 Jürg Billeter 2010-10-03 Jürg Billeter gtk+-3.0: Update to 2.91.0 cairo: Update to 1.10.0 2010-10-03 Luca Bruno Support adding new source files while visiting the code tree Move package adding logic to CodeContext Move source file adding logic to CodeContext 2010-10-02 Evan Nemerson 2010-10-02 Jukka-Pekka Iivonen 2010-09-21 Florian Brosch 2010-09-17 Jürg Billeter 2010-09-07 Evan Nemerson 2010-08-19 Evan Nemerson 2010-08-03 Evan Nemerson 2010-08-02 Evan Nemerson 2010-08-02 Luca Bruno doclets/gtkdoc: Fix finding headers and handling of external C files doclets/gtkdoc: Call pkg-config only for existing packages 2010-08-02 Evan Nemerson glib-2.0: Add g_logv binding. 2010-07-31 Florian Brosch 2010-07-30 Michael Terry 2010-07-30 Evan Nemerson 2010-07-16 Jürg Billeter 2010-06-30 Jürg Billeter 2010-06-28 Jürg Billeter 2010-06-19 Jürg Billeter 2010-06-18 Aaron Andersen 2010-06-18 Evan Nemerson 2010-06-02 Evan Nemerson 2010-05-19 Evan Nemerson 2010-05-19 Florian Brosch 2010-05-10 Michael 'Mickey' Lauer 2010-05-04 Evan Nemerson 2010-04-27 Luca Bruno 2010-04-27 Allison Barlow 2010-04-26 Evan Nemerson 2010-04-25 Evan Nemerson 2010-04-09 Michael 'Mickey' Lauer 2010-04-06 Nicolas Bruguier 2010-04-06 Evan Nemerson 2010-04-02 Evan Nemerson 2010-03-28 Jürg Billeter 2010-03-21 Adam Folmert 2010-03-12 Jürg Billeter 2010-03-11 Jürg Billeter 2010-02-18 Martin Olsson 2010-02-18 Luca Bruno 2010-02-11 yselkowitz 2010-02-01 Michael 'Mickey' Lauer 2010-01-28 Adrien Bustany 2010-01-18 Marc-André Lureau 2009-11-22 Michael 'Mickey' Lauer 2009-11-10 Evan Nemerson 2009-11-10 Ali Sabil 2009-10-30 Florian Brosch 2009-10-25 Florian Brosch 2009-10-19 Didier "Ptitjes 2009-10-18 Florian Brosch 2009-10-15 pancake 2009-10-11 Didier 'Ptitjes 2009-10-02 Jürg Billeter 2009-09-26 Mark Lee 2009-09-26 Shawn Ferris 2009-09-17 Jürg Billeter 2009-09-16 Yu Feng 2009-09-16 Jürg Billeter 2009-09-16 Florian Brosch 2009-09-16 Jürg Billeter 2009-09-15 Jürg Billeter 2009-09-14 Jürg Billeter 2009-09-11 Florian Brosch 2009-07-28 Jürg Billeter 2009-07-10 Jürg Billeter 2009-06-22 Florian Brosch 2009-06-21 Florian Brosch 2009-04-14 Jürg Billeter 2009-03-30 Jürg Billeter